Originally posted by duffyboy211

Since you responding now...I have a post concerning the Frontlines gamemode that now have almost 400 upvotes but no response yet from any of you guys. Any info on that gamemode coming back or why it was removed in the first place? And look no animosity towards you honestly just a frustrated customer looking for answers after months of uncertainty of where this "live service" game is heading

Hey DB,
The removal of Frontlines from having a regular spot in the playlists was based on what players were playing more of (and ensuring that matchmaking would be successful within the playing population) - that's why we randomly bring out modes like Frontlines, Grind, Outpost, Fortress.

Not to deflect the conversation, but you can run Frontlines Community Games - it is missing quite a few features, bells, and whistles that RSP had, but it is still possible to have some great Frontlines matches.
